Understanding the Pan-European Emergency Number
112 is the universal emergency number across the European Union and many other countries. It works for police, fire, and medical services, and is free to call from any phone.
How 112 Works Across Europe
When you dial 112, you are connected to the local emergency services. The number is operational in all EU member states, and many non-EU countries also use it. It is designed to be easy to remember and works even without a SIM card.

The Saturday Quiz: Test Your Knowledge
Here are the questions from the Saturday quiz. See how many you can answer correctly before checking the answers below.
- 1. Emily Firmin was the only human in which children’s TV series?
- 2. What is the most spoken language written in Devanagari script?
- 3. Which brothers were, respectively, King of Scots and High King of Ireland?
- 4. What is the pan-European emergency telephone number?
- 5. Who has trained a record 12 Epsom Derby winners?
- 6. Where is the bus station a classic of brutalist architecture?
- 7. Who is said to have found the True Cross in Jerusalem in the fourth century?
- 8. Whose last general election victory was in 1906?
- 9. What links: Photographed by Luna 3; Berlin 1961-89; Judith Chalmers series; Wind in the Willows, ch 7?
- 10. Adventure Galley; Fancy; Queen Anne’s Revenge; Royal Fortune; Whydah?
- 11. Daedalus; George London and Henry Wise; Adrian Fisher?
- 12. LA Dodgers; San Francisco Giants; New York Jets; New York Giants?
- 13. Maestro; Taking Sides; Tár; Unfaithfully Yours?
- 14. Satoshi; Wei; lamport; lovelace?
- 15. John II; Louis Philippe I; Napoleon III?
Answers and Explanations
Check your answers below. The correct answers are:
- Bagpuss
- Hindi
- Robert the Bruce and Edward Bruce
- 112
- Aidan O’Brien
- Preston
- St Helena (Emperor Constantine’s mother)
- Liberal party (Campbell-Bannerman)
- Pink Floyd albums: The Dark Side of the Moon; The Wall; Wish You Were Here; The Piper at the Gates of Dawn
- Pirate ships: Captain Kidd; Henry Every; Blackbeard; Bartholomew Roberts; Sam Bellamy
- Famous maze designers: Cretan labyrinth in myth; Hampton Court maze; present day
- Sports teams that have moved out of New York (NY Jets and Giants NFL sides now play in New Jersey)
- Films about conductors
- Subdivisions of cryptocurrencies: bitcoin; Ethereum; Solana; Cardano
- French rulers who died in exile in England: 1364; 1850; 1873
